## Authentication

If your plugin hooks into the StockSquare reconciliation job, it needs to call our internal ledger service, and that means bringing a key along. Plugins without one get rejected before the first batch runs, no exceptions. Pop it into your plugin config under the auth section. The key to use is below.

app token of hahig-yawip = zpat11_7vvKNZ1kAOl

Heads up — this alert fires when the Fairgate ticket-pricing experiment drifts outside its guardrails, e.g. if the variant arm starts charging more than 15% over the control or conversion craters. Since you're new: don't panic, the experiment auto-pauses itself. Your job is just to confirm the pause happened and note it in the log. The escalation steps are written up on this page.

operations page: https://jenkins.zemvarcloud.local/job/merge_requests/repo/build/73930b4b30f0a8ed

Ticket: Config drift in Quillpress render pipeline

Staging renders footnotes differently from prod. Root cause: someone hand-edited the markdown renderer flags on two staging hosts and never committed. Fix: re-apply managed config, then enable drift alerts. New folks: never edit live configs directly, always go through the deploy repo. Canonical renderer values below.

config for fajep-hawif:
[fraok]
team = ralmir
access_code = ac_a9a4bc
host = fraok.sivrelio.corp
port = 9000
owner = jorir.fenvan
peer = zorius.orvexgrid.internal

- [ ] **Step 7: Breaker override escrow.** After sealing the signing keys for the Tallgrove upstream API circuit breaker, confirm the support team can force the breaker open during a full outage. The override bundle lives in the sealed escrow drawer and is useless without its unlock phrase. Two ceremony witnesses must initial this step before proceeding. The escrow bundle is decrypted with the recovery passphrase that follows.

vault phrase of kahip-kahop = holath-quenmir